Introduction to Laravel Development
In the fast-paced digital landscape, businesses are constantly seeking robust, scalable, and secure web applications to stay competitive. Laravel, an open-source PHP framework, has emerged as one of the most preferred choices among developers worldwide due to its elegant syntax, flexibility, and advanced features. Choosing a professional Laravel Development Company can help you harness the full potential of this framework, ensuring your business has a high-performing, feature-rich web application tailored to your unique requirements.
What is Laravel and Why It’s Popular?
Laravel is a modern web application framework designed to simplify the development process by providing developers with clean, expressive syntax. It is built on the Model-View-Controller (MVC) architectural pattern, which ensures separation of logic and presentation. Laravel provides features like routing, authentication, caching, and session management, all of which contribute to faster and more efficient development. One of the main reasons businesses prefer Laravel is its ability to reduce development time while maintaining performance and security.
Key Features That Make Laravel Stand Out
A reliable Laravel Development Company leverages the framework’s powerful features to deliver world-class web solutions. Some of Laravel’s standout features include:
-
Blade Templating Engine: Laravel’s Blade engine allows developers to create dynamic layouts effortlessly while maintaining performance and simplicity.
-
Eloquent ORM (Object-Relational Mapping): Eloquent provides an intuitive and expressive syntax for interacting with databases, making complex queries simple.
-
Artisan CLI: Laravel’s command-line interface, Artisan, automates repetitive tasks, improving productivity and efficiency.
-
Built-in Authentication and Authorization: Laravel simplifies the implementation of secure authentication systems for user management.
-
Security and Data Protection: Laravel offers CSRF protection, encrypted cookies, and secure routing, ensuring your web application remains safe from vulnerabilities.
-
MVC Architecture: The Model-View-Controller structure organizes code logically, making it easier to maintain and scale applications.
-
Automatic Package Discovery: Laravel allows developers to install packages easily without additional configuration, enhancing workflow.
Why Businesses Choose a Laravel Development Company
Hiring a professional Laravel Development Company offers numerous advantages over in-house development or freelance programmers. These companies bring together experienced developers, designers, and project managers who work collaboratively to deliver top-tier web solutions. Some of the key reasons businesses opt for a Laravel development firm include:
-
Expertise and Experience: A specialized company employs Laravel experts who understand the framework inside out. They know how to build scalable and high-performing applications that meet business objectives.
-
Custom Development Solutions: Every business has unique needs. Laravel companies create tailored web solutions designed specifically to fit your brand’s requirements.
-
Time and Cost Efficiency: With streamlined processes and dedicated teams, Laravel firms ensure quicker turnaround times without compromising on quality.
-
Ongoing Maintenance and Support: A professional development company doesn’t just deliver your project—they provide long-term maintenance, updates, and technical support.
-
Latest Technology Integration: Laravel development companies stay updated with the latest versions and tools, ensuring your website remains technologically advanced.
Services Offered by a Laravel Development Company
Top Laravel development firms provide a comprehensive range of services to cater to different business needs. Here are some common offerings:
-
Custom Laravel Web Development – Companies build fully customized web applications that align with your business goals and user expectations.
-
Laravel Enterprise Solutions – For large-scale organizations, Laravel is ideal for developing enterprise-grade systems that are fast, reliable, and secure.
-
Laravel API Development – Laravel’s built-in support for RESTful APIs makes it perfect for building mobile app backends and third-party integrations.
-
E-commerce Development – Laravel supports e-commerce frameworks like Bagisto and Aimeos, allowing developers to create scalable online stores.
-
Migration and Upgradation Services – Expert Laravel developers help migrate legacy systems to Laravel or upgrade your current application to the latest version.
-
Laravel Maintenance and Support – Professional teams monitor and maintain your applications, ensuring maximum uptime and security.
-
Third-Party Integration – Laravel development companies can integrate payment gateways, social logins, CRMs, and analytics tools seamlessly.
Benefits of Partnering with a Laravel Development Company
When you collaborate with a dedicated Laravel Development Company, your business gains several benefits beyond just development expertise.
-
Faster Development Cycles: Laravel’s ready-to-use tools and templates allow companies to deliver projects faster.
-
Enhanced Security: Laravel includes built-in protection against SQL injection, cross-site scripting, and other vulnerabilities.
-
High Scalability: Laravel applications can easily scale with growing user demands and traffic.
-
Improved Performance: Features like caching, optimization, and database management make Laravel applications lightning-fast.
-
Seamless Integration: Laravel supports integration with cloud services, email tools, and third-party APIs, expanding your web application’s functionality.
-
Cost-Effective Solutions: Outsourcing Laravel development to a professional company reduces infrastructure and hiring costs.
Laravel Development for Different Industries
Laravel’s flexibility makes it suitable for various industries. Whether you’re a startup or an established enterprise, a Laravel development firm can tailor solutions for your niche.
-
E-commerce and Retail – Laravel helps build robust online shopping platforms with secure payment processing and inventory management.
-
Healthcare – Laravel enables the creation of HIPAA-compliant applications with secure data management and appointment systems.
-
Education and E-learning – Develop interactive learning management systems, online course platforms, and virtual classrooms.
-
Finance and Banking – Laravel’s advanced security ensures safe financial transactions and data protection.
-
Travel and Hospitality – Build booking platforms, itinerary management tools, and travel portals using Laravel.
-
Media and Entertainment – Laravel supports content management, streaming services, and subscription-based platforms.
Steps Involved in Laravel Web Development Process
A structured development process ensures timely delivery and high-quality results. A reputable Laravel Development Company typically follows these steps:
-
Requirement Analysis – Understanding business goals, target audience, and technical needs.
-
Planning and Wireframing – Creating a detailed project roadmap and UI/UX design structure.
-
Development Phase – Coding the application using Laravel’s best practices and modular structure.
-
Testing and Quality Assurance – Conducting rigorous testing to ensure bug-free performance and security compliance.
-
Deployment – Launching the application on a secure server environment.
-
Post-launch Support – Continuous monitoring, maintenance, and updates for optimal performance.
Laravel vs Other Frameworks: Why Laravel Leads
Laravel has gained immense popularity compared to other frameworks like CodeIgniter, Symfony, or Yii due to its advanced features and developer-friendly environment. Unlike CodeIgniter, Laravel offers built-in authentication and a powerful ORM system. Its expressive syntax and extensive community support also make it more developer-friendly. Furthermore, Laravel’s ecosystem includes tools like Vapor (serverless deployment) and Nova (admin panel), giving businesses a competitive edge.
How to Choose the Right Laravel Development Company
Selecting the right development partner is crucial for project success. Here’s what to look for when hiring a Laravel Development Company:
-
Portfolio and Experience: Check previous projects and case studies to evaluate their expertise.
-
Technical Proficiency: Ensure the company uses the latest Laravel versions and tools.
-
Client Testimonials: Read client reviews and feedback to gauge reliability.
-
Communication and Transparency: The company should maintain clear communication throughout the project.
-
Post-Deployment Support: Confirm that they offer maintenance and updates after project delivery.
-
Cost and Timeline: Compare pricing structures and ensure they align with your budget and schedule.
Future of Laravel Development
As technology evolves, Laravel continues to expand its ecosystem with new updates and features. The framework is becoming increasingly compatible with AI, cloud computing, and IoT integrations. Laravel’s continued growth and community support ensure it remains one of the most future-ready frameworks for web application development. Partnering with a Laravel Development Company that stays updated with these advancements ensures your business stays ahead of the curve.
Conclusion: Empower Your Business with Laravel Excellence
In today’s competitive online world, having a robust, secure, and scalable web application is vital. Laravel offers everything businesses need to build dynamic and high-performing websites and applications. By collaborating with a professional Laravel Development Company, you gain access to expert developers, innovative technologies, and a seamless development process that guarantees success. Whether you’re a startup looking for your first online platform or an enterprise upgrading your systems, Laravel provides the perfect foundation to bring your vision to life.
The right Laravel partner can turn your ideas into impactful digital experiences that drive engagement, growth, and profitability. So, choose wisely and elevate your business with the power of Laravel.